VPS Hosting: The Ideal Choice for Growing Businesses
A VPS is a virtualized server that simulates a dedicated environment, offering more control and flexibility than shared hosting. With a VPS, you'll have access to your own dedicated resources, such as CPU, memory, and storage, which can be allocated according to your needs. This level of control enables you to customize your server setup, install specific software, and configure security settings tailored to your business requirements.
- Benefits of VPS Hosting:
- Increased control and flexibility
- Customizable server setup
- Improved security and reliability
- Scalable resources
Shared Hosting: The Budget-Friendly Option for Small Businesses
Shared hosting, on the other hand, involves multiple websites sharing the same physical server. This setup is ideal for small businesses or personal websites, as it offers an affordable way to get online without breaking the bank. However, shared hosting comes with some limitations, such as shared resources, which can lead to slower website speeds and potential security risks.

Key Considerations for Choosing Between VPS and Shared Hosting
When deciding between VPS and shared hosting, it's essential to consider your business needs, budget, and growth prospects. Ask yourself:
- Do you require full control over your server setup and resources?
- Are you expecting a significant increase in traffic or resource demands?
- Can you afford the higher costs associated with VPS hosting?
If you answered 'yes' to the first two questions, VPS hosting might be the better choice for you. However, if budget is a concern and you're just starting out, shared hosting could be a more feasible option.
